The lack of work during the busy harvest period plagued many farmers. in order to solve the problem of seasonal technical shortage and stabilize the agricultural labor force, the Council of Agriculture cooperated with farmers to launch agricultural technology missions and agricultural new farming groups and other organizations throughout Taiwan. So far, the agro-technical mission has set up 14 delegations in various counties and cities, and about 697 members have participated in it. The main categories of industrial and agricultural products are fruit trees and vegetables, and the demand is high because the shortage of workers is mostly seasonal. At present, the number of people has reached 29369. As for the major vegetable producing areas and the agricultural producing areas with labor shortage problems, by 108, a total of 17 agricultural new groups had been set up, with 20-30 farmers enrolled in each regiment, with the purpose of providing a stable agricultural labor force in the region. and improve the problem of low-skilled labor shortage.

Holding a high cash crop red quinoa in his hand under the scorching sun, 34-year-old Lai Jianhong's eyes are full of happiness. He introduces the harvest and farming experience of red quinoa. It is hard to imagine that he was a shift operator at the Taipei Printing Factory more than two years ago. Now he is an agricultural master of the Pingbei regiment in Pingtung, and he is also a representative of young people returning to their hometown. Farming has always been his dream, and the agricultural technical team has helped him realize this dream.

Lai Jianhong lives with his wife and 2-year-old daughter in Zuoying, Kaohsiung. He commutes to and from Pingbei farm in Pingtung like an office worker every day, working with different farmers regularly to experience all kinds of farming. He said that he had a desire to farm at the beginning, but he ran up against a brick wall everywhere when he went to find land and farming opportunities. Fortunately, he saw the relevant information of the agricultural technology mission. After he signed up for the training, two years of practical experience enabled him to accumulate a lot of agricultural knowledge. Learning with farmers even enabled him to acquire "practical secrets" that he could not learn in textbooks.

Lai Jianhong first planted fragrant lemons in the Pingbei regiment, and later, including eggplant and jujube, participated in the planting and harvest, joined the agro-technical mission, and made him go from scratch to have, just like the strategy of a video game, to familiarize himself with farming practice in the shortest time, and to provide him with the direction and reference of finding land and selecting crops in the future.

Zhang Tingwei, a 26-year-old member of the Hsinchu Emei regiment, worked as an ironworker before joining the agricultural farming regiment last year. Later, he signed up online, and then attended successive lecture courses after passing the interview, and then practiced on the farm. The rotation of different farms every three months from tea to orchards allowed him to learn a lot of different farming experiences. For the future, he hopes to stay in the new agricultural regiment. You can not only learn from different farmers, but also have a job with a stable income.

Chang Ting-Wei, a farmer, also admitted that few young people want to do this now. After all, it is a work of relative labor, but he actually observed that there will be a shortage of workers in a lot of agriculture in Taiwan. He very much hopes to use his example to encourage young people to join new agricultural groups to fight for Taiwan's agriculture.

Focusing on solving the current situation of agricultural labor shortage, the agro-technical mission currently adopts a more open selection method at the front end in order to obtain more people who are willing to engage in agricultural work. The first stage selection conditions do not set a threshold for age, gender, past work experience, etc., but are selected first through a wide range of candidates during the data review period. In addition, due to the higher physical requirements of agricultural field work, it was also screened through physical fitness tests in the first stage of selection.
